Introduction

Cheerios iron is an essential nutrient found in Cheerios cereal, making it a popular choice for individuals seeking a healthy breakfast option. Iron plays a crucial role in the body, as it helps transport oxygen in the blood and supports overall energy levels. Cheerios, made from whole grain oats, not only provide a delicious crunch but also offer a fortified source of iron, which is beneficial for both children and adults.

FAQs

Cheerios typically contain about 4.5 mg of iron per serving, which contributes to your daily iron needs.

Yes, Cheerios are fortified with iron, making them a good source to help meet your daily iron intake.

Yes, Cheerios can be a helpful part of a diet aimed at addressing iron deficiency, especially when combined with other iron-rich foods.

Other foods high in iron include red meat, beans, lentils, spinach, and fortified cereals.

To enhance iron absorption, consider pairing Cheerios with vitamin C-rich foods like oranges or strawberries.
